Installing Egress Windows
Turning your basement into a functional living space often requires incorporating an egress window. These specialized windows serve a crucial role, providing a vital means of evacuation route in case of emergency. Beyond safety, improving your basement with an egress window can raise its overall value and appeal to potential buyers. Skilled installation is essential to ensure proper airflow, security, and compliance with building codes.
